The senatorial bid of Senator Mao Ohuabunwa of the Peoples Democratic Party, PDP, Abia North, received a major boost as some decampees from other political parties declared their support for him as their consensus candidate for the February 25 Abia North senatorial contest.
The decampees who visited the Senatorial Candidate in company of some religious leaders all from Bende local government area Observed that Ohuabunwa, stands out among all contestants for the seat, hence their support.
They resolved to put behind their individual political differences, and support one of their own who they said is a seasoned Parliamentarian with experience.
The former Senate Committee Chairman on Primary Health and Communicable Diseases, said that National Assembly members who voted against electronic transmission of election results should not be rewarded with a return ticket to NASS, describing them as the real enemies of Nigeria’s democracy.
He promised to restore the dignity and voice of Abia North if voted into power, adding that he will leverage on his legislative edge and national contacts to end insecurity in Abia North.
Ohuabunwa regretted that those who were elected to speak for Abia North abandoned the people to their fate at the height of insecurity in the zone, but promised to change the narrative if given the opportunity to return to the red chamber.
